مرحله 2: Google Analytics را یکپارچه کنید
| مقدمه: تبدیل تبلیغات iOS را اندازه گیری کنید |
مرحله 1: حساب تبلیغاتی خود را با Google Analytics پیوند دهید |
مرحله 2: Google Analytics را یکپارچه کنید |
| مرحله 3: مشکلات رایج را عیب یابی و رسیدگی کنید |
اکنون که حساب تبلیغات خود را مرتبط کرده اید، می توانید ادغام Google Analytics برای Firebase SDK را آغاز کنید.
Google Analytics برای Firebase SDK را ادغام کنید
با آخرین نسخه Google Analytics برای Firebase SDK یکپارچه شوید.
از کوکوپود استفاده کنید
اگر برنامه شما از Cocoapods استفاده میکند، بررسی کنید که Podfile پروژهتان حاوی غلاف GoogleAppAdsOnDeviceConversion است، از طریق غلاف اصلی FirebaseAnalytics یا با گنجاندن صریح آن بهعنوان یک غلاف مستقل:
pod 'FirebaseAnalytics' # includes GoogleAdsOnDeviceConversion
یا
pod 'FirebaseAnalytics/Core'
pod 'GoogleAdsOnDeviceConversion'
سپس دستورات pod repo update و pod install را اجرا کنید.
از Swift Package Manager استفاده کنید
اگر برنامه شما از Swift Package Manager استفاده میکند، مراحل Swift Package Manager را برای Firebase دنبال کنید. وقتی به مرحله «انتخاب کتابخانههای Firebase که میخواهید در برنامهتان اضافه شوند» رسیدید، قبل از ادامه مراحل بعدی، FirebaseAnalytics بررسی کنید. یا FirebaseAnalytics/Core و GoogleAdsOnDeviceConversion را بررسی کنید.
ادغام جایگزین
اگر برنامه شما از Cocoapods یا Swift Package Manager استفاده نمی کند، به صورت زیر ادغام کنید:
- فایل فشرده عمومی Firebase را از مخزن firebase-ios-sdk GitHub دانلود کنید.
- دستورالعمل های README را از فایل فشرده عمومی دنبال کنید تا چارچوب ها را مستقیماً به پروژه اضافه کنید. مطمئن شوید که چارچوب ها را از دایرکتوری
FirebaseAnalyticsاضافه کنید. - در Xcode، پرچمهای
-ObjCو-lc++را به سایر تنظیمات لینکر در تنظیمات ساخت هدف برنامه خود اضافه کنید.
ادغام را تأیید کنید
حالت اشکال زدایی را با افزودن -FIRDebugEnabled در زیر Arguments Passed on Launch در ویرایشگر طرح Xcode فعال کنید.
برنامه را در شبیه ساز یا دستگاه حذف کنید. پس از راه اندازی برنامه در Xcode، بررسی کنید که پیامی مانند زیر در کنسول اشکال زدایی Xcode ظاهر شود:
[Firebase/Analytics][I-ACS023007] Analytics v.X.X.X started
...
[Firebase/Analytics][I-ACS023009] Debug logging enabled
...
[FirebaseAnalytics][I-ACS023278] Conversion service GoogleAdsOnDeviceConversion framework is linked
حدود 15 ثانیه صبر کنید و بررسی کنید که پیام _psmvalue_gads در کنسول اشکال زدایی Xcode ظاهر شود:
[FirebaseAnalytics][I-ACS023087] User property set. Name, value: _psmvalue_gads, X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
مرحله 1 حساب تبلیغات خود را با Google Analytics پیوند دهید مرحله 3 : عیب یابی و رسیدگی به مشکلات رایج